MCP Servers Collection

This repository contains a collection of Model Context Protocol (MCP) servers that can be used with Amazon Q, Claude Desktop, and other LLMs that support the MCP protocol.

Available MCP Servers

  • Capital.com MCP Server: Exposes the Capital.com trading API as MCP tools for trading operations
    • Search for markets (e.g., EURUSD, AAPL)
    • Get account information and positions
    • Create and manage trading positions
    • Access watchlists

What is MCP?

Model Context Protocol (MCP) is an open protocol that standardizes how applications provide context to LLMs. MCP enables communication between the system and locally running MCP servers that provide additional tools and resources to extend LLM capabilities.

Using with Amazon Q

  1. Create an mcp.json configuration file in your Amazon Q configuration directory (~/.aws/amazonq/mcp.json):

    {
      "mcpServers": {
        "capital-com-mcp-server": {
          "command": "uvx",
          "args": ["capital-com-mcp-server"],
          "env": {
            "CAPITAL_BASE_URL": "https://demo-api-capital.backend-capital.com",
            "CAPITAL_API_KEY": "your_api_key_here",
            "CAPITAL_PASSWORD": "your_password_here",
            "CAPITAL_IDENTIFIER": "[email protected]",
            "FASTMCP_LOG_LEVEL": "ERROR"
          }
        }
      }
    }
    
  2. Run Amazon Q with:

    q chat
    
  3. Amazon Q will automatically start the MCP server and connect to it.

Using with Claude Desktop

  1. In Claude Desktop, go to Settings > Developer section and click on "Edit Config"

  2. This will open the configuration file. Add the following to the JSON:

    {
      "mcpServers": {
        "capital-com-mcp-server": {
          "command": "uvx",
          "args": ["capital-com-mcp-server"],
          "env": {
            "CAPITAL_BASE_URL": "https://demo-api-capital.backend-capital.com",
            "CAPITAL_API_KEY": "your_api_key_here",
            "CAPITAL_PASSWORD": "your_password_here",
            "CAPITAL_IDENTIFIER": "[email protected]",
            "FASTMCP_LOG_LEVEL": "ERROR"
          }
        }
      }
    }
    
  3. Save the file and restart Claude Desktop.

Development

To add a new MCP server to this collection:

  1. Create a new directory under src/ with your server name
  2. Add the necessary files for your MCP server implementation
  3. Include a pyproject.toml and setup.py in the server directory
  4. Add a README.md with usage instructions

Publishing

Each MCP server can be published to PyPI independently:

cd src/your_mcp_server
uv build
uv pip publish

GitHub Actions

This repository uses GitHub Actions to automatically build and publish packages to PyPI when a new release is created. The workflow is configured to use a matrix strategy, allowing each package to be built and published independently.

To add a new package to the publishing workflow, update the matrix in .github/workflows/python-publish.yml:

strategy:
  matrix:
    package: [capital_com_mcp_server, your_new_mcp_server]
